提示:本回答由AI生成,内容仅供参考。
在代码中实现错误处理和异常处理是非常重要的,它能帮助我们在开发过程中及时捕获和处理潜在的错误或异常情况,避免程序崩溃或出现不可预期的结果。这对于保证系统的稳定性和用户的一致体验至关重要。以下是两种常见的错误处理和异常处理的方法及其在代码中的实现。
一、错误处理
在编程中,错误处理主要是通过捕获和处理异常来实现的。当代码中发生异常时,我们应该立即采取措施来处理这些异常,例如记录日志、回滚数据、通知用户等。
在实现错误处理时,我们可以使用异常类来封装和处理具体的异常情况。例如,在Python中,我们可以使用try-except语句来捕获和处理异常。当发生异常时,程序会执行相应的代码块,我们可以使用try语句来尝试执行可能会引发异常的代码,然后使用except语句来捕获和处理具体的异常类型。
二、异常处理
异常处理主要是通过抛出异常和捕获异常来实现的。当代码中出现异常情况时,我们可以选择抛出异常给调用者,以便调用者能够进行相应的处理。同时,我们也需要编写代码来捕获和处理这些异常。
在实现异常处理时,我们可以使用try-except-finally语句来确保无论是否发生异常,代码都会执行完毕。在try语句中执行可能会引发异常的代码,如果发生异常,我们可以使用特定的异常处理逻辑来处理这些异常。同时,我们也可以在finally语句中执行一些清理工作,例如关闭资源、记录日志等。
总的来说,错误处理和异常处理是编程中不可或缺的一部分。通过合理的错误处理和异常处理机制,我们可以更好地保证程序的稳定性和可靠性,提高代码的质量和用户体验。
转载请注明出处:https://www.psfa.cn/9200.html
热门推荐
- 防火墙如何防止网络攻击?
- 如何提高公众对环境污染问题的关注度和参与度?
- 社交场合中的问候用语有哪些礼仪规范要求?
- 跑步速度和节奏如何调整以提高效率?
- 阅读灯对于儿童阅读的照明有何特殊要求和建议?
- 对于追求安静和舒适感的朋友们,书房的布置有什么特别的考虑和建议?
- 除湿机的优点和适用范围有哪些?
- 随着5G网络的普及,智能手机的性能表现如何预测?5G技术对智能手机有何影响?
- 如何延长蔬菜的新鲜度?
- 爵士乐在不同国家和地区的风格有哪些差异?
- 建筑测绘的精度和测量误差的影响因素有哪些?
- 在不同环境和用途下,防水涂料应该如何选择和应用?
- 在进行书评写作时,有哪些实用性的写作工具或技巧可以帮助提高效率和质量?
- 您认为如何才能更好地参与和推动阅读马拉松活动的发展?
- 《民法典》中对于土地承包经营权的法律保护有哪些规定?
- 不同空间类型的室内净高要求是否有所不同?
- 羽毛球运动中的裁判标准是怎样的?
- 蚁后是什么?它在生态系统中的作用是什么?
- 深度学习模型的优化需要哪些技术和工具支持?
- 羽毛球运动中的身体素质要求是什么?
网页更新时间:2026-05-02 19:28:46
本页面最近被 156 位网友访问过,最后一位访客来自 广西,TA在页面停留了 65 分钟。